The Forge — rune to dragon
The Forge is an experimental anvil in the Mire working yard where smiths turn rune gear into dragon gear — the server's marquee coin-and-materials sink, and the reason runite bars matter at endgame.
How to use it
Bring a hammer, the rune item, the runite bars and the fee, then use the rune piece on the Forge:
| Upgrade | Smithing | Runite bars | Fee |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rune scimitar → Dragon scimitar | 60 | 30 | 500,000 gp |
| Rune med helm → Dragon med helm | 60 | 30 | 400,000 gp |
| Rune full helm → Dragon full helm | 65 | 50 | 800,000 gp |
| Rune kiteshield → Dragon kiteshield | 70 | 70 | 1,500,000 gp |
| Rune platelegs → Dragon platelegs | 70 | 80 | 1,500,000 gp |
| Rune platebody → Dragon platebody | 75 | 100 | 2,500,000 gp |
Every bar consumed grants 50 Smithing XP, so a platebody upgrade is 5,000 XP on top of the gear.
Remember the armour gate
Forging dragon armour doesn't mean you can wear it — dragon requires the Lord title (2,000,000 gp rank). See Titles & citizenship. Plenty of smiths forge for profit and sell to Lords instead.
Where the bars come from
Runite ore is in the castle cellar mine and Mire collection grounds (Mining 85); each runite bar needs 8 coal (Smithing 85, or Superheat Item). The Trading Post also stocks adamantite bars and coal if you'd rather buy your way in — see Trading Post & the market.
